    I was terrified to talk to anyone, but what helped me is the realization that, once you've been accepted, programs enter a kind of "recruitment mode." They're trying to ensure they get their top choices. So, in my limited experience so far, everyone is extremely friendly and understanding. I think they're just as interested in making good first impressions as we are. Just relax (easier said than done, I know) and ask what you're genuinely curious about--not what you think will impress anyone. Read over the department/program websites one more time, and I'm sure you'll come up with something. Also, a good thing to ask is how you should contact them with the follow-up questions you weren't able to think of during the phone call.
